STADIUM UPGRADE

Sophia Gardens is now 14 years old and has needed refurbishment and an upgrade for some time.

Over the winter, the Club has undertaken a major maintenance project around the ground to improve facilities and enhance our customer experience. We have been busy replacing more than 12,000 old seats, painting the stadium infrastructure and upgrading the toilets.

With work around the stadium not yet complete, the Pro Steel Engineering Grandstand will be out of operation for this fixture.

While Members and supporters will be able to watch live action from all the other stands, we would like to apologise for the inconvenience caused and ask for your patience as we complete this much-needed work.

SUSTAINABILITY & SCORECARDS

Sustainability has long been an important topic at Glamorgan and this winter we have undertaken several initiatives to reduce our waste and become more sustainable as a Club.

As well as appointing Joe Cooke as our sustainability champion and setting up a ‘Green Team’ to look at improved ways of working, we have installed water fountains throughout the stadium to aid our push to stop the reliance on single-use plastic.

Further initiatives include moving away from plastic cups to eco-friendly reusable ones in our Members' lounge. We will supply Members with porcelain mugs for their teas and coffees pre-match and during intervals rather than disposable coffee cups. Please note that Members will be unable to take these outside The Lewis Lounge, however, our catering team will be happy to fill Members' flasks before you return to your seats.

In our public areas we have removed plastic single-use disposable pint glasses.

The Club is also looking at ways of reducing our paper waste and we have identified the printing of scorecards as a potential method.

We realise that scorecards are important to our Members and will therefore print a batch on day one for our LV= County Championship fixtures, for collection from the Club shop, Reception or the Lewis Lounge. Digital versions will be available to download and print at home via our Match Zone on the website.
